Output d43343763ffd1bb9c496c91ba6b417f5ab6cc5dcdd521dcb2193e3435c8930ff:0

value
126151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c7fa224de315404041fac7404579aa7b7b792a OP_EQUAL
address
3MMxmSQRhQNWRiqRakmXakV3JATqSrQFkZ
transaction
d43343763ffd1bb9c496c91ba6b417f5ab6cc5dcdd521dcb2193e3435c8930ff